This Sound Card sounds great. But if I'm going to be honest, in terms of sound quality, there is no significant difference in music sound quality between the onboard sound of my Asus Z490 motherboard and the New Audio. There is also no difference between sound quality in my external audio interface and this sound card. Nowadays, most audio chips sound great, and beyond a certain price point, it all sounds good.
However, the Nu Audio has a much more powerful amplifier then the onboard sound. It can fully drive all my audio gear and there doesn't seem to be any electrical interference from the graphics card. Also, the RGB looks cool! If you don't want to buy an external USB powered audio device to save space, then this card is great for that.
Installation was quite easy... But some things to consider. Make sure you get a SATA cable with 5 wires and preferably just connect straight to the PSU without any other devices on the line to reduce chances of electrical interference. If you don't see the RGB turn on when you power up your computer, then something is wrong.
Also, DOWNLOAD THE MOST RECENT DRIVERS. At the time of this writing, the version you should download is 2.1.14. EVGA's website isn't designed well, and it is easy to download the original version 1.2.3 driver from their website. They really need to fix that.

The good: Its true, the Nu audio card is superior than my on-board audio chip. All lossless audio sound much deeper/richer. My setup: Foobar2000 to NU L/R to HiFi home stereo system ($$$). Under $200, I strongly think its a reasonable purchase.
The bad: Hardware power issue - Couldn't use a molex, because the molex is incapable of transfering 3.3v. I didn't know this until I went to the EVGA NU Audio FAQ web page.
MP3 and other lossy audio file are just lost. Not even the NU Audio can help improve the sound.
